Cobleskill Baseball Falls Twice at RussMatt Invitational to Clarkson & SUNY Farmingdale

Box Score 1 | Box Score 2 Winter Haven, Fla.: The SUNY Cobleskill men's baseball team suffered a pair of tough losses at the 2018 RussMatt Central Florida Baseball Invitational at the Chain of Lakes Park Stadium. The Fighting Tigers lost to Clackson University by a 9-7 margin in the day's opener then dropped an 11-9 decision to SUNY Farmingdale in 10 innings. With the losses the Fighting Tigers fall to 0-6 overall on the year.
 
Against Clackson in the opening game the Fighting Tigers trailed by six runs entering the fourth inning before making a spirited comeback effort eventually tying the contest at 7-7 when junior catcher Daren Palmer, West Haverstraw, N.Y., Jefferson Community College, doubled home the tying run with his second double of the day.
 
However Clackson rallied in the eighth with a pair of runs to put the contest out of reach.
 
In the second game the Fighting Tigers and Rams engaged in a rollercoaster contest which featured three ties and four lead changes as both teams posted comebacks after falling behind.
 
The Fighting Tigers trailed early in the contest as five errors led to six unearned runs and hurt an otherwise strong pitching effort from freshman Ryan O'Keefe, Albany, N.Y., Albany High School, who allowed nine runs, only three of which were earned, while striking out four in six and a third inning of work.
 
Cobleskill came back to tie the game in the bottom of the eighth inning when freshman catcher Corey Tingo, Selden, N.Y., Newfield High School, doubled advanced to third on a ground out and scored on a sacrifice fly by freshman right fielder Zyere Molinaro, Summit, N.Y., Cobleskill-Richmondville High School, with one out.
 
In the 10th inning the Rams tallied twice to take the lead from which the Fighting Tigers could not overcome.
 
The Orange & Black will close out the Invitational when the face St. Olaf for a pair of games on Friday beginning at 9:00 a.m.
